In light of the placement of blood on the inner altar – either one or two placements – preserving the atonement capacity of the offering, even without blood placed on all four corners, the question of blood on the curtain (parokhet) must be asked. The Gemara establishes that all seven placements must be made on the curtain – but it asks also about four placements, because of a verse with a plural term and R. Shimon’s opinion. Also, why does the Torah specify the need for incense on the inner altar (which was the incense altar), as the terms are redundant? Plus, the focus on the verses as source material for the halakhic details.
Zevahim 40: The Curtains and the Incense
